** Sensory Space

Sensory modulation is used to help people self-regulate their emotions and behavior with sensory stimulation. Sensory spaces are designed to meet the sensory needs of the person/group accessing them.

Accessible Gaming

Gaming is a recreational pursuit, a fun way to engage in a variety of skills. The alternative reality of in-game experiences are not only enjoyable, but can improve skills such as timing, decision making, planning and problem solving.

Buying Second-hand Equipment

Buying used items or second-hand items can save you money but does not provide the same consumer protection rights as when buying new items. It is important to check the product’s condition before buying or accepting second-hand goods.

Checklist for Home Design

When modifying or building a home, it is important that it suits your current, future and changing needs. Design that caters for possible changes, such as using assistive equipment, can save time and money, ensuring the home is suitable in the long-term.

Environmental Control Units

Environmental Control Units (ECUs) are devices that assist individuals in accessing and controlling their environment. ECUs can increase quality of life and independence for people with disabilities by providing easier-control devices for individual needs
